I know that it is a pretty simple editor with some emacs feel to it. 1.) Is the "emacs" feel of xedit a part of text widgets in general? Will I find the same key bindings in other applications that use text widgets? 2.) How do I alter or add to the xedit configuration? The man page says something about a binding file .XtActions and implies that the .XtActions file is included with the X11 release. I've not found it. (If someone is willing to e-mail me a copy of their .XtActions file for an example I'd sure appreciate it.) 3.) Is there a way to cause tab characters to show up when I type them in? The way xedit is set up on my machine, a tab character is inserted in the text and shows up when the file is printed, but the cursor does not move when I am in xedit.
